Lingfield today

Lingfield is the only meeting left today and will be staging jumps racing for a change. The ground will be very heavy and although all races look quite straightforward, we can still expect some surprise results and stakes should be kept to a minimum. The opening mares novice hurdle at 13.30 CET looks a match between Hidden Identity (Tim Vaughan/ Richard Johnson), carrying a double penalty, and Shesha Bear (Johnny Portman/ Hadden Frost); they met over this CD last time when the former won by 3 lengths, but the latter has a chance of reversing the form on 7 lbs better terms. We still prefer the former, who had winning form on heavy ground when trained in Ireland. There is a similar situation in the novice hurdle at 14.30 with the penalised Hollow Penny (Alan King/ Choc Thornton) again meeting Until Winning (Tom George/ Paddy Brennan) after beating him last month by 7 lengths at Bangor; this time we will side with the horse with the lighter weight, though again there should be litlte in it. In the following novice chase at 15.00 it is Sire de Grugy (Gary and Jamie Moore) who has to give weight away; he is potentially a smart performer and we think he can still get the better of Cantlow (Paul Webber/ Tony McCoy), who made an excellent chasing debut at the beginning of the month. This is the best race of the day, even though the other 3 runners appear to have no chance.

Gary Moore can double up woth bottom-weight Well Refreshed, this time with his younger son Joshua in the saddle, in the handicap chase at 16.00. Obviously Pete the Feat (Charlie Longsdon/ Gavin Sheehan) is a danger after winning his last 3 races, but he has never run on ground as heavy as this and has so far not shone at this track. Theoretically Pete the Feat is still well in, as he is due to go up in the weights again next week, but we are not sure that he can concede so much weight to Well Refreshed, or to Pensnett Bay (Jo Hughes/ Micky Grant), who ran well at Sandown, for that matter.

Laura Mongan usually does well here and we expect Rosoff (Richard Johnson) to take the handicap chase at 14.00. The handicap hurdle at 15.30 is the only zrickier race of the day. although Dormouse (Marie King/ Tony McCoy) is bound to be favourite after winning the last twice; he has also won on heavy ground, but does seem so well handicapped now. Mongan has possibilities here too with Synthe David (Tom Cannon), while Lindsay´s Dream (Zoe Davison/ Gemma Gracey-Davison) could also go well. Basically these races all look too easy to be true, so be prepared for surprises!
